
In June 2009, a picture of Reg, the owner of the Reynolds Supermarket, and of an unknown lady, were fixed either side of an older mural of St Helen’s Church.

In August 2014 the pictures of Reg and the lady finally came down.

Another street scene put up on the Reynolds Way Wall in June 2009

is coming away from the wall in August 2014.
Most of the original murals from over ten years ago, made with tiles, and paint on the wall, are still doing well; but the newer ones painted on board, have lasted about five years. The notice board lasted even less. It has been mended and broken again.
